Talking about the capex cycle, The Indian Railways is set to get a capital expenditure push of Rs 2.45 lakh crore in the financial year 2022-23, 14 percent higher than the budgeted capital expenditure of Rs 2.15 lakh crore for the current financial year
The Indian Railways has drawn up a huge ₹34,000 crore safety upgrade of its network that involves deployment of an automatic train protection system – Kavach, developed by the RDSO under railway ministry, (collaboration with Medha Servo Drives, HBL Power and Kernex Microsystems)
Currently Railways has been using decade old anti-collision device (ACD) developed by Konkan Railways, termed ‘Raksha Kavach’. While the older system is still in use in most trains at the moment, the new system will be introduced across all trains in the next five years.
The new system is also a lot more accurate in sending signals to trains and faster as it works on a real time basis while implementing safety measures. The indigenously-developed anti-collision technology is SIL4 certified -probability of a single error in 10,000 years.
Implementation Of Kavach
Indian Railways plans to install Kavach across
2,000 rail route networks -2022-23
4,000-5,000 rail route networks every subsequent year
To install Kavach across the entire 68,446 km.Expect to completely shift to the new anti-collision system by 2028

Cost of Project Kavach -30-50 lakh per kilometre (1/4th compared to ₹2 crore in other parts of the world). Private player will be given a timeframe of 2-3 years to implement the same. HBL Power will benefit immensely from application of TCAS and TMS by Indian Railways.
It received approval for TCAS to be deployed in auto-signalling sections of Indian Railways network. Being the first Indian supplier with field experience of installing TMS and CTC systems in Eastern Railway and Kolkata Metro, HBL is well placed to secure a decent market share
They won contract from Siemens for installing TMS in the Eastern DFCC project in FY21. At the moment Kavach uses ultra-high frequency radio waves but Indian Railways is working to make it compatible with 4G (LTE) technology and develop the product for global markets Export Case
HBL in collaboration with Ericsson, set up the LTE communication infra at its R&D centre to develop the required interfaces between TCAS and LTE. This is the first such facility in India. Signed an MoU with Ericsson, under which HBL will deploy LTE networks for Indian Railways.
Apart from above triggers , battery vertical is one of the major revenues spinners for the company followed by Electronics segment. The company is gradually working to reduce its dependence on telecom sector and increasing its concentration towards defence and railways.
HBL is currently minimising exposure to lesser-attractive commodity businesses like lead battery operations as its highly competitive and focusing more on value added offerings like Nickel Cadmium and PLT battery businesses and evaluating new avenues around lithium chemistry
PLT Batteries
HBL is only Indian company to offer high powered Pure Lead Thin Plate (PLT) battery. Company is seeing growing preference for PLT batteries in data center applications, while export volume of these batteries for battle tank application has gained traction.

Tubular Gel batteries
Bagged large orders for supply of tubular gel batteries for Energy Storage Systems (ESS) from L&T and BEL. To expand product offerings for Energy Storage Solutions (ESS), the Company will leverage its capability around lithium ion battery technology

Nickel Cadmium Batteries
Sustained leadership in the Nickel Cadmium Pocket Plate (NCPP) battery space in India. Successfully executed large orders for the supply of NCPP batteries to Gail pipeline projects and OEM supplier to aircrafts manufactured by Airbus, IAI and Bombardier

Defence
Commenced manufacture and supply of Type I batteries for Kilo class submarine and Varunasthra torpedo batteries to Navy. Absorbed technology from NSTL (Naval Science and Technology Laboratory) for manufacture and supply of Lithium-ion batteries for defence applications

Electric Drive Train
Developed Electric Drive Train kits for retrofitting light commercial vehicles and passenger buses.Kit comprises high efficiency traction motor, power electronics controller and high power lithium battery packs. Expects to secure approval for the kit - FY22

EV Motors
HBL offers two major EV motors
Radial flux Reluctance Motor - Integrated in medium and large commercial vehicles like buses and trucks
Axial flux Permanent Magnet Synchronous Motor (AF-PMSM) - Designed for high-performance drives, using stators and rotors

Capex
Manufacturing facility at Hyderabad for Lithium Ion cells and Electric Drive Train (EDT). Cost of capex-Rs 110 cr- Completion in two phases (Debt Rs.80 crore and balance through internal accruals). Phase I completion -Q4FY22 and Phase II -after completion of Phase I

Risk
No management interaction with shareholders. Major risk here can be delay in implementation of Kavach by Indian railways and inability to shift from Lead Battery Division to value added products. Emergence of better efficient technology in Motors

Last few quarters there has been sequential growth, Within June 2021 to March 2022, EBITDA has grown from 15 cr to 53 cr suggesting inflection point for the business. It remains to be seen how the company executes in future.
Most of its verticals witnessing very good tailwinds apart from the lead battery business. Specially application of TCAS and TMS is a big opportunity with supply side being limited to 3 companies. Source - Annual Report, Credit Rating Reports, ETNow & money Control articles.
